When there is a lack of water and food, the victims' needs become primarily focused on survival. Here are the needs they might have:

  1. Clean Water: This is the most essential need. The human body can only survive for about three days without water. In a disaster situation, clean drinking water might not be readily available, leading to dehydration and disease.

  2. Food: After water, food becomes the next critical need. The human body can survive longer without food than without water, but lack of food leads to malnutrition, weakness, and eventually starvation.

  3. Safety and Security: In situations where victims resort to looting for food and water, it's clear that there's a breakdown in law and order. Therefore, victims need safety from potential violence and security for the little resources they might have.

  4. Health Care: Lack of clean water and adequate food can lead to various health issues. Victims would need access to medical care to treat any illnesses or injuries that might occur.

  5. Shelter: While not directly related to the lack of food and water, victims would also need a safe and secure place to stay, especially in harsh weather conditions.

  6. Information: Victims need to know where they can find help, such as locations of aid distribution centers, safe zones, etc.

  7. Emotional Support: Experiencing a disaster is traumatic. Victims would need emotional and psychological support to cope with their situation.

  8. Restoration of Normalcy: In the long term, victims need help to restore their normal lives. This includes rebuilding homes, finding employment, etc.
